To ensure a smooth transition for all Hotmail customers, the upgrade will be gradual. This is the start of that upgrade process. Please refer to the steps below on how to do this.
- Sign in to Outlook.com.
- Click the gear icon on the upper right corner beside your name.
- Select More mail settings.
- Under Managing your account click Sending automated vacation replies.
- Enter the message you'd like to send while you're away.
- Click Save.
In addition, note that there's some features that might be turned off for newly created Microsoft accounts.
- Sending automated vacation replies (auto reply option)
- Email signature
- POP aggregation (send Hotmail email with any email address)
- Forwarding email
- Reply-To address (receive replies to Hotmail email at a different email address)
- Send-As address (send email in Hotmail from other email addresses)
